Fitment Breakdown: Vertini RFS1.7 on the Honda Accord Sport 2021

I walked up to this Accord at the last meet and the stance floored me. We are looking at a 20x9 front and 20x10 rear setup that pushes the limits of the tenth-gen chassis. That aggressive +15 offset on all four corners is what makes the wheels sit perfectly flush with the fenders.

Most guys play it safe with stock offsets, but this build screams confidence. The low offset brings the spokes right out to the edge of the paint. You get that deep, concave look that the 2021 Accord Sport frame desperately needs to look complete.

The Vertini RFS1.7 design gives you plenty of breathing room for those factory Sport calipers. I checked the clearance and there is zero risk of the spokes hitting the housing. You get a clean, open look that shows off the brakes without needing massive spacers.

We need to talk about that 20-inch diameter. On the 2021 platform, a 20-inch wheel fills the massive wheel arches without looking like a cartoon. It strikes the perfect balance between show car aesthetics and daily drivability.

The air suspension is the secret sauce here. When this owner dumps the bags, the fender lips tuck just inside the tire sidewalls. It is a precise fit that avoids the dreaded paint-cracking contact.

If you run this setup at ride height, watch your inner fender liners. That +15 offset is aggressive, so you might catch some plastic if you do not roll your fenders slightly. A little bit of negative camber goes a long way to keeping the tires happy.

The hub bore on these Vertinis matches the Accord perfectly. We hate dealing with hub-centric rings that fail after a few thousand miles. This setup mounts tight and stays true even when you hit a bump at highway speeds.

What We Recommend for Honda Accord Sport 2021 Owners

Listen, if you want this look, do not cut corners on your tire choice. We recommend a mild stretch to help the tires clear those fender edges when the car is slammed. A 245/35 front and a 255/35 rear tire setup works wonders here.

Staggered setups look mean on the Accord, but they require discipline. You have to keep your overall rolling diameter close to stock to protect your transmission. We have seen too many guys ruin their wheel speed sensors by guessing the math.

Avoid the temptation to use cheap slip-on spacers. If your offset is wrong, you need a custom-built wheel, not a hardware-store band-aid. Properly fitted wheels like these Vertinis are safer and look infinitely cleaner.

I always tell our readers to invest in a quality alignment after installing air. You need a bit of front negative camber to keep the tread out of the fender metal. Without a professional alignment, you will burn through a set of tires in one summer.

Think about your daily commute before you go full show-mode. If you have big speed bumps in your neighborhood, you need to manage your air pressure carefully. This setup is beautiful, but it demands a driver who respects the machine.

Full Specs Breakdown

Here is exactly what this owner is running. We break down every detail so you can replicate this build or use it as a starting point for your own setup.

  • Car Make & Model: Honda Accord Sport 2021
  • Vehicle Color:
  • Wheel Brand & Model: Vertini RFS1.7
  • Wheel Size: 20×9 / 20×10
  • Offset: 15 / 15
  • Wheel Finish: Machine finish
  • Tires: Lexani LX-Twenty 235/35 26.5″x9.3″ / 255/35 27″x10″
  • Suspension: Air Suspension

We talk to Honda Accord Sport owners every day. These are the questions we hear most before they pull the trigger on new wheels.

Will 20×9 / 20×10-inch wheels fit my Honda Accord Sport? Yes, but fitment depends on width, offset, and tire size working together. A wrong offset means rubbing. A wrong tire size means poor handling. Always verify all three.

Do I need to modify my fenders? That depends on your offset and suspension. A conservative offset with stock ride height usually fits without modification. Go aggressive and you may need to roll or pull your fenders.

Can I daily-drive this setup? Absolutely. Thousands of Honda Accord Sport owners run 20×9 / 20×10-inch wheels every day. The key is choosing the right tire with enough sidewall to absorb road imperfections.
